Key types for cars vary and it's essential to know what kind of key your car uses before you get a spare car key made a spare key made. There are three types of car keys: basic keys as well as smart keys and fobs. Basic keys are mechanical car keys that have been around for many decades. They are easy to obtain a copy of and don't require any special encryption.

Fobs are the electronic keys that are usually found in modern automobiles. They can be more difficult to replace in the event that you lose them as they need to be programmed. However, they are more secure than standard keys, since they contain an embedded chip that sends an electronic signal to the car's ignition and door locks.

Smart keys are the most recent technology for car keys. They have a built-in remote that operates the car's locks, trunk and glove box, and are often programmed to store different settings. They are more expensive than mechanical keys to replace, but could be worth it if concerned about your car being stolen.
